Retail Management Wages Near Scottsbluff

OccupationMedian Annual Wage (Nebraska, statewide)
First-Line Supervisor of Retail Sales Workers$45,280
General and Operations Manager$85,090
Sales Manager$126,990

Source: BLS, May 2025 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ics publishes wage data at the metro (MSA) and state level – not by individual city.


Scottsbluff at a Glance

MetricValueSource
Population14,406Census ACS 2023 5-yr (B01003)
Median household income$53,448Census ACS 2023 5-yr (B19013)
Adults 25+ with bachelor’s+27.2%Census ACS 2023 5-yr (B15003)

How do I verify a program is accredited?

Confirm institutional accreditation via the U.S. Department of Education database (U.S. Dept. of Education database), and check for any program-specific accreditation listed by the school.
